Please explain your issue is in as much detail as possible.
In this scenario the convoy tanks do not stay together but spread out so far that they all stop moving, with the message that they are too far away from the battlemechs. The first tank speeds into the enemy and quite often dies, while the furthest behind tank is usually an LRM launcher and will fire off its missles without moving, and the demolisher tank is just way slower and also get left behind. I believe that because the tanks do not stay together and move together, this causes the linkage with the battlemechs to become broken and doesnt fix itself. I have repeated this battle several times and this always happens in some form. The lead tank will rush straight into the enemy in a suicidal rush, even if i dont travel with them, or even if I rush ahead of them, but then the linkage breaks with the tanks that stay behind.
